## What It Does
Instead of pixel-based navigation that breaks when UI changes:
```bash
# Fragile - breaks if UI changes
idb ui tap 320 400
# Robust - finds by meaning
python scripts/navigator.py --find-text "Login" --tap
```
Uses semantic navigation on accessibility APIs to interact with elements by their meaning, not coordinates. Works across different screen sizes and survives UI redesigns.

## Quick Start
```bash
# 1. Check environment
bash ~/.claude/skills/ios-simulator-skill/scripts/sim_health_check.sh
# 2. Launch your app
python ~/.claude/skills/ios-simulator-skill/scripts/app_launcher.py --launch com.example.app
# 3. See what's on screen
python ~/.claude/skills/ios-simulator-skill/scripts/screen_mapper.py
# Output:
# Screen: LoginViewController (45 elements, 7 interactive)
# Buttons: "Login", "Cancel", "Forgot Password"
# TextFields: 2 (0 filled)
# 4. Tap login button
python ~/.claude/skills/ios-simulator-skill/scripts/navigator.py --find-text "Login" --tap
# 5. Enter text
python ~/.claude/skills/ios-simulator-skill/scripts/navigator.py --find-type TextField --enter-text "user@test.com"
# 6. Check accessibility
python ~/.claude/skills/ios-simulator-skill/scripts/accessibility_audit.py
```

## Usage Examples
### Example 1: Login Flow
```bash
# Launch app
python scripts/app_launcher.py --launch com.example.app
# Map screen to find fields
python scripts/screen_mapper.py
# Enter credentials
python scripts/navigator.py --find-type TextField --index 0 --enter-text "user@test.com"
python scripts/navigator.py --find-type SecureTextField --enter-text "password"
# Tap login
python scripts/navigator.py --find-text "Login" --tap
# Verify accessibility
python scripts/accessibility_audit.py
```
### Example 2: Test Documentation
```bash
# Record test execution
python scripts/test_recorder.py --test-name "Login Flow" --output test-reports/
# Generates:
# - Screenshots per step
# - Accessibility trees
# - Markdown report with timing
```
### Example 3: Visual Testing
```bash
# Capture baseline
python scripts/app_state_capture.py --output baseline/
# Make changes...
# Compare
python scripts/visual_diff.py baseline/screenshot.png current/screenshot.png
```
### Example 4: Permission Testing
```bash
# Grant permissions
python scripts/privacy_manager.py --bundle-id com.example.app --grant camera,location
# Test app behavior with permissions...
# Revoke permissions
python scripts/privacy_manager.py --bundle-id com.example.app --revoke camera,location
```
### Example 5: Device Lifecycle in CI/CD
```bash
# Create test device
DEVICE_ID=$(python scripts/simctl_create.py --device "iPhone 16 Pro" --json | jq -r '.new_udid')
# Run tests
python scripts/build_and_test.py --project MyApp.xcodeproj
# Clean up
python scripts/simctl_delete.py --udid $DEVICE_ID --yes
```
## Design Principles
**Semantic Navigation**: Find elements by meaning (text, type, ID) not pixel coordinates. Survives UI changes and works across device sizes.
**Token Efficiency**: Default output is 3-5 lines. Use `--verbose` for details or `--json` for machine parsing. 96% reduction vs raw tools.
**Accessibility-First**: Built on iOS accessibility APIs for reliability. Better for users with accessibility needs and more robust for automation.
**Zero Configuration**: Works immediately on any macOS with Xcode. No complex setup, no configuration files.
**Structured Data**: Scripts output JSON or formatted text, not raw logs. Easy to parse, integrate, and understand.
**Auto-Learning**: Build system learns your device preference and remembers it for next time.

## Output Efficiency
All scripts minimize output by default:
| Task | Raw Tools | This Skill | Savings |
|------|-----------|-----------|---------|
| Screen analysis | 200+ lines | 5 lines | 97.5% |
| Find & tap button | 100+ lines | 1 line | 99% |
| Enter text | 50+ lines | 1 line | 98% |
| Login flow | 400+ lines | 15 lines | 96% |
This efficiency keeps AI agent conversations focused and cost-effective.
## Troubleshooting
### Environment Issues
```bash
# Run health check
bash ~/.claude/skills/ios-simulator-skill/scripts/sim_health_check.sh
# Checks: macOS, Xcode, simctl, IDB, Python, simulators, packages
```
### Script Help
```bash
# All scripts support --help
python scripts/navigator.py --help
python scripts/accessibility_audit.py --help
```
### Not Finding Elements
```bash
# Use verbose mode to see all elements
python scripts/screen_mapper.py --verbose
# Check for exact text match
python scripts/navigator.py --find-text "Exact Button Text" --tap
```
